Yemen's Polio Outbreak May Spread


(Vax Before Travel)

The International Health Regulations national focal point for Yemen notified the WHO of circulating vaccine-derived poliovirus type 2 (cVDPV2) in stool samples from children with acute flaccid paralysis (AFP) in Yemen.

As per the report released, the WHO Emergency Committee expressed concern at the continued rapid spread of cVDPV2 to many countries and noted that the risk of international spread of cVDPV2 is currently high. 

On December 9, 2021, the WHO reported the first case, a girl from Thubab district, Taiz governorate, south-western Yemen. She experienced an onset of paralysis on August 30. The child had not been vaccinated against polio. Two stool samples were collected, and VDPV2 was confirmed on November 22, with ten nucleotide differences from the Sabin type 2 poliovirus vaccine strain.

The second case, a 26-month-old girl from Marib district, Marib governorate, north-east of Sana’a city, experienced onset of paralysis on September 1. The child had also not been vaccinated against polio. Stool specimens were collected, and VDPV2 was confirmed on November 22 with 11 nucleotide differences from the Sabin type 2 poliovirus vaccine strain.
